Bill Amend (born
September 20,
1962 in
Northampton,
Massachusetts) is an
American
cartoonist, best known for his
comic strip FoxTrot.
Born as
William J. C. Amend III, Amend attended high school in
Burlingame,
California where he was a cartoonist on his school
newspaper. Amend is an
Eagle Scout in the
Boy Scouts of America. He attended
Amherst College, where he drew comics for the college paper. He majored in physics and graduated in 1984. In 1982 Amend took first place among sophomores in a mathematics prize examination at Amherst.
After a short time in the animation business, Amend decided to pursue a cartooning career and signed on with
Universal Press Syndicate.
FoxTrot first appeared on
April 10,
1988.
Amend currently lives in the
midwestern United States with his wife and two children, a boy and girl.
On
May 21,
1999, Amherst College awarded him an
honorary degree as Doctor of Humane Letters.
Amend made a
television appearance on
The Screen Savers, which aired
October 20 2003 on the former
TechTV. Amend is also an avid
World of Warcraft player, but refuses to reveal his character's name, although he did mention in an interview with Allakhazam.com (a World of Warcraft fan site) that he played on the server 'Bronzebeard' (Jason is often shown or referred to playing "World of Warquest" in the strip).
On
December 5 2006, Universal Press Syndicate issued a
press release stating that Amend's strip,
FoxTrot, would turn into a Sunday-only strip. Amend stated that he wants to continue doing the strip, but at a less hurried pace. This news was followed by several weeks of the characters discussing a "cartoonist" semi-retiring to Sundays only, and what methods he'd use to phase out the daily strips. The last daily Foxtrot cartoon was printed on December 30, 2006.
On
May 26 2007, Amend was presented with the
Reuben Award for Outstanding Cartoonist of the Year.
